Johnson & Johnson is recruiting for a Sr Manager IMSC Information Architecture located in in either Titusville, NJ; Raritan, NJ; Zug, CH; Schaffhausen, CH; Leiden, NL; Cork, IE; Latina, IT or Beerse, BE.
As we are building out our Data Strategy and Operations organization as part of our Value Chain Management organization in the Innovative Medicine Supply Chain, we are creating this role as part of our Data Strategy and Operations Team, under the Information Architecture pillar.
The Sr Manager IMSC Information Architecture leads and oversees the information architecture for 1-2 specified functional business domains (e.g. Plan, Source, Deliver, Make, Quality, Advanced Therapies)
As Sr Manager IMSC Information Architecture Make and Quality, you will be responsible for leading the design and implementation of E2E Data Products for Make and Quality, ensuring they are FAIR and aligned with IMSC Data Architecture.
You will develop and adopt central strategies to minimize duplication of information and maximize clarity on source of truth across different supply chain functions and systems.
Your focus will be end-to-end and span from system specific master data (including supporting workflow capabilities), transactional data and data for analytics and AI.
You will collaborate with the functional partners in the supply chain and the J&J Technology partners to design and implement scalable data models that maximize value for the business partners.
Key Responsibilities:
Design and implement E2E FAIR Data products for 1-2 domain across Master and Transactional data to generate Data Products for Analytics
Create adopt and evolve IMSC conceptual and logical business information policies to guide data product design and modelling
Work in close collaboration with the domain Data Owners to shape the Data Domain roadmap and ensure budget and resources are allocated
Work in close collaboration with the Data Owners to define metadata and data quality framework to ensure high level of FAIR data products throughout their lifecycle.
In collaboration with the domain Data Owners, support the IMSC Data Governance to implement governance capabilities across Data Domain
Continuously implement Automation and simplification through advanced capabilities like AI-agents into the processes of data design, data asset build and data quality controls.
In collaboration J&J Technology technical partners, support the evolution of a E2E data stack that can support future AI applications in the domains
Qualifications
Education:
Master’s degree in Engineering, Business, Technology, Computer Science or with a focus on data management/ data science / Analytics / AI / Machine Learning, or equivalent
Experience and Skills:
Required:
In depth experience of data modelling and design technique (medallion architecture, Data Vault, Data Marts, OBT etc)
In depth experience of state of the art data technologies (Workflow capabilities for Master data, Data catalogues, Lakehouse, Ontology management)
5+Experience working in a pharmaceutical global supply chain
Experience in multi-year strategy or technology deployment with focus on information management, data management or data capabilities
Proven track record to build partnership to inspire change and deliver results across complex ecosystems.
Excellent communication skills and ability to simplify complex technical topics for broad audiences across levels.
Energetic, passionate, accountable, keen on continuous learning.
Preferred:
Good knowledge of industry standards related to data management (FAIR, IDMP, ISO etc.)
Good knowledge of compliance standards
Experience working in healthcare
